WebAn ingot is a piece of relatively pure material, usually metal, that is cast into a shape suitable for further processing. Web3.1 Cast Billet Ingots — For the purpose of this standard, cast billet ingot shall be defined as ingot, generally of cross-section not more than 200 mm 2 which can be rolled directly into merchant products.
